# Software Download & Installation Guide ## Overview ICreateCode is a graphical programming software independently developed by ICreateRobot. It works with multiple products such as the ICRobot, ICBricks, and micro:bit, enabling interactive projects that combine hardware and software. ## System Requirements ICreateCode supports both **macOS** and **Windows**. **Note:** For Windows, a **64-bit** system is required, Windows 10 or later. ## Download Download the software from the official[ ICreateRobot ](https://www.icrobot.com/www/cn/index.html#/file/index?type2=ICRobot)website. ## Installation Locate the downloaded installer package, then double-click it. ![](img/S1.png) When the installation window appears, click “我同意”(I Agree) to accept the license agreement. ![](img/S2.png?x-oss-process=image%2Fformat%2Cwebp) By default, select “Install for me only”, then click Next. Note: You will be prompted to choose whether to install the software for the current user only or for all users on the computer. The difference is as follows: 1. This option installs the software for the current user account only. After installation, only this user can access and use the software. 2. This option installs the software for all user accounts on the computer. Any user on this device will be able to run the software. ![](img/S9.png) Choose installation path: It is recommended to install to Disk C. If C drive space is insufficient, click Browse to choose another drive. Click Install and wait for the process to complete. ![](img/S3.png?x-oss-process=image%2Fformat%2Cwebp) Just wait for the installation to be complete. ![](img/S4.png) Click mouse to complete, and then the network access permission will pop up. **Be sure to select Allow.** ![](img/S5.png) ![](img/S6.png) The software is installed. ![](img/S7.png) ## Notes ![](img/S8.png) To ensure the software functions properly: + If the computer goes into sleep mode and then wakes up, the software will start a 1-minute countdown to save your project. + After that, the software will restart automatically.